用VibeThinker-1.5B做算法题,结果超出预期!

用VibeThinker-1.5B做算法题,结果超出预期!

在当前大模型普遍追求千亿参数、超大规模训练数据的背景下,微博开源的VibeThinker-1.5B-WEBUI却以仅15亿参数和极低训练成本(约7,800美元),在数学推理与算法编程任务中展现出惊人的性能表现。部署后实测发现,该模型在LeetCode风格题目上的解题准确率远超同类小模型,甚至逼近部分20B级别通用模型。

本文将基于实际使用经验,深入分析 VibeThinker-1.5B 在算法题求解中的核心能力、技术优势及工程落地要点,并提供可复现的最佳实践建议。


1. 模型背景与核心定位

1.1 小参数但高专注:专为逻辑推理而生

VibeThinker-1.5B 是一个密集型Transformer架构语言模型,参数量仅为1.5B。尽管其规模远小于主流大模型,但在设计之初就明确了目标场景:高强度逻辑推理任务,尤其是竞赛级数学问题和算法编程挑战(如AIME、Codeforces、LeetCode等)。

这一定位使其跳出了“泛化即智能”的误区,转而聚焦于构建强大的符号推理能力和结构化思维链生成机制。相比通用对话模型,它更像是一个“解题专家”,擅长处理形式化表达、递推关系、边界判断和多步推导。

1.2 成本效益比惊人:训练投入不到8K美元

最令人震惊的是其极低的训练成本——据官方文档披露,总训练开销约为7,800美元。这一数字远低于Phi-2(>20万美元)或GPT-OSS系列模型(百万级)。之所以能实现如此高效训练,关键在于三点:

  • 高质量、高密度的数据筛选:训练语料主要来自竞赛题库、官方题解、AC代码等富含逻辑信息的资源,噪声极少;
  • 分阶段任务对齐训练:经历“通用预训练 → 领域微调 → 强化学习优化”三阶段流程,逐步提升推理一致性;
  • 轻量化部署优先设计:模型尺寸适配消费级GPU(FP16下显存占用<6GB),避免后期压缩带来的性能损失。

这种“少而精”的策略显著提升了单位数据的学习效率,使得小模型也能在特定领域达到甚至超越更大模型的表现。


2. 实践应用:如何用VibeThinker-1.5B解决算法题

2.1 部署与启动流程

根据镜像文档说明,VibeThinker-1.5B-WEBUI 的部署非常简便,适合个人开发者快速上手:

# 步骤1:拉取并运行镜像 docker run -p 8080:8080 vibe-thinker-1.5b-webui # 步骤2:进入Jupyter环境 # 访问 http://localhost:8080 -> 打开 /root 目录 # 步骤3:执行一键推理脚本 ./1键推理.sh # 步骤4:通过网页界面进行交互 # 点击控制台“网页推理”按钮即可打开Web UI

整个过程无需深度学习背景,普通用户也可在本地RTX 3090或云服务器上完成部署。

2.2 关键配置:系统提示词决定模型行为

由于该模型未针对通用对话优化,必须在系统提示词输入框中明确指定任务角色,否则输出可能偏离预期。

推荐使用的系统提示词如下:

You are a programming assistant specialized in solving competitive programming problems. Please solve each problem step by step, explain your reasoning clearly, and output correct code in Python. Use English for better accuracy.

实验表明,添加此类提示后,模型的推理连贯性和代码正确率显著提升,尤其是在需要多步推导的问题中表现尤为突出。


3. 核心能力解析:为何能在算法题上脱颖而出?

3.1 多步推理链的稳定构建

传统小模型在面对复杂算法题时,常因注意力分散或上下文断裂而在中间步骤出错。而 VibeThinker-1.5B 展现出较强的推理链维持能力

以一道典型的模运算问题为例:

“Find all integers $ n $ such that $ n^2 + 5n + 1 \equiv 0 \pmod{7} $.”

普通模型可能直接枚举错误或跳过验证,而 VibeThinker-1.5B 能自动拆解为以下逻辑步骤:

  1. 明确模7下只需验证 $ n = 0,1,\dots,6 $
  2. 对每个值代入计算表达式
  3. 判断是否满足同余条件
  4. 汇总符合条件的结果

这种能力源于其训练过程中大量接触类似题型所形成的“隐式推理模板”。例如:“遇到模运算 → 枚举剩余类”、“涉及二次方程 → 尝试配方法或判别式分析”。

更重要的是,模型具备一定的自我验证意识。在生成最终答案前,会尝试回溯关键步骤,检查是否存在矛盾。虽然仍无法完全杜绝幻觉,但在限定领域内的稳定性远超同类小模型。

3.2 编程任务中的算法直觉与工程规范

在 LiveCodeBench v6 测试中,VibeThinker-1.5B 取得了51.1的得分,略高于 Magistral Medium(50.3),接近部分20B级别通用模型的表现。其强项体现在两个方面:

(1)问题拆解与算法匹配能力

面对“最长连续序列”问题(要求O(n)时间复杂度):

""" Given an unsorted array of integers nums, return the length of the longest consecutive elements sequence. Your algorithm must run in O(n) time. """

模型能够正确识别排序方案会导致O(n log n)超时,转而采用哈希集合实现O(1)查找,并巧妙地利用“仅从序列起点开始扩展”的优化策略:

def longestConsecutive(nums): num_set = set(nums) longest = 0 for num in num_set: # Only start counting if num-1 is not present (i.e., it's the start of a sequence) if num - 1 not in num_set: current_num = num current_streak = 1 while current_num + 1 in num_set: current_num += 1 current_streak += 1 longest = max(longest, current_streak) return longest

该实现不仅逻辑正确,命名清晰,还包含关键注释,说明模型已内化了算法思想,而非简单记忆代码片段。

(2)边界条件处理能力强

在动态规划类题目中,模型对初始状态和边界判断的处理也较为严谨。例如,在“爬楼梯”问题中,能准确设置dp[0] = 1,dp[1] = 1,并在循环中合理控制索引范围,避免越界。


4. 性能对比与选型建议

4.1 多维度性能对比

维度VibeThinker-1.5BPhi-2 (2.7B)GPT-OSS-20B
参数量1.5B2.7B20B+
训练成本~$7,800>$200,000>$500,000
数学推理(AIME24)80.3<60~85
编程表现(LCB v6)51.1~40~55
部署难度单卡可运行(<6GB FP16)需高端GPU分布式集群
设计目标竞赛级推理专用通用对话+轻度推理全能型任务处理

可以看出,尽管参数最少、预算最低,VibeThinker-1.5B 在专项任务上的表现已逼近甚至局部超越更大模型。这再次印证了一个趋势:在特定领域,数据质量与任务对齐的重要性,远胜于单纯扩大参数规模

4.2 使用建议与最佳实践

为了最大化发挥 VibeThinker-1.5B 的潜力,建议遵循以下实践原则:

  1. 始终提供系统提示词
    如不声明“你是一个编程助手”或“请逐步推理”,模型可能输出无关内容。务必在输入前设定角色。

  2. 优先使用英文提问
    由于训练语料中英文科技文献占比较高,英文输入的准确率明显优于中文。建议将题目翻译为英文后再提交。

  3. 拆分复杂问题为子任务
    对于长链推理问题(如多层嵌套DP),建议将其分解为多个独立查询,逐个求解后再整合结果,避免上下文截断。

  4. 结合人工审核输出
    虽然模型能生成高质量代码,但仍可能存在边界遗漏或逻辑漏洞。建议对关键函数进行单元测试验证。

  5. 适用于特定人群

    • 学生:用于练习AIME/Codeforces级别数学题,获得即时反馈;
    • 程序员:辅助准备技术面试,快速掌握高频考点;
    • 教师/研究员:作为教学工具或初步验证猜想的手段。

5. 总结

VibeThinker-1.5B 的成功并非偶然,而是“任务导向+高质量数据+精细化训练”三位一体的结果。它证明了在特定领域,小模型完全可以通过精准设计实现“以巧破力”,在数学推理和算法编程任务中媲美甚至超越更大模型。

对于希望低成本部署AI解题系统的个人或团队而言,VibeThinker-1.5B 提供了一个极具吸引力的选择:单卡即可运行、训练成本极低、推理表现优异。

更重要的是,它代表了一种可持续、普惠化的人工智能发展路径——未来的AI生态,或许不再是几个超级模型统治一切,而是成千上万个专业化模型协同工作。每个人都能拥有属于自己的“AI协作者”。

而 VibeThinker-1.5B,正是这一趋势的先行者。


获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/1175566.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

实测Qwen1.5-0.5B-Chat:轻量级AI对话效果超预期

实测Qwen1.5-0.5B-Chat&#xff1a;轻量级AI对话效果超预期 1. 引言&#xff1a;为何需要更小的对话模型&#xff1f; 随着大模型技术的快速演进&#xff0c;行业正从“参数规模至上”转向“效率与实用性并重”。尽管千亿级模型在复杂任务上表现出色&#xff0c;但其高昂的部…

YOLO26效果展示:从图片到视频的检测案例

YOLO26效果展示&#xff1a;从图片到视频的检测案例 在智能监控、工业质检和自动驾驶等实时性要求极高的应用场景中&#xff0c;目标检测模型的推理速度与精度平衡至关重要。近年来&#xff0c;YOLO系列持续演进&#xff0c;其最新版本 YOLO26 在保持高帧率的同时进一步提升了…

Hunyuan MT1.5-1.8B冷门语言支持:藏语新闻翻译准确率实测报告

Hunyuan MT1.5-1.8B冷门语言支持&#xff1a;藏语新闻翻译准确率实测报告 1. 背景与测试动机 随着多语言AI模型的快速发展&#xff0c;主流语言之间的翻译质量已接近人类水平。然而&#xff0c;在低资源、小语种场景下&#xff0c;尤其是涉及民族语言如藏语、维吾尔语、蒙古语…

腾讯混元模型实战:HY-MT1.5-1.8B与现有系统集成

腾讯混元模型实战&#xff1a;HY-MT1.5-1.8B与现有系统集成 1. 引言 在企业级多语言业务场景中&#xff0c;高质量、低延迟的机器翻译能力已成为全球化服务的核心基础设施。HY-MT1.5-1.8B 是腾讯混元团队推出的高性能翻译模型&#xff0c;基于 Transformer 架构构建&#xff…

家庭服务器部署Qwen萌宠模型:24小时可用方案

家庭服务器部署Qwen萌宠模型&#xff1a;24小时可用方案 随着AI生成内容技术的快速发展&#xff0c;家庭场景下的个性化应用需求日益增长。许多家长希望为孩子提供安全、有趣且富有创造力的数字体验。基于阿里通义千问大模型开发的 Cute_Animal_For_Kids_Qwen_Image 正是为此而…

java当中TreeSet集合(详细版)

TreeSet集合的概述&#xff08;1&#xff09;不可以存储重复元素&#xff08;2&#xff09;没有索引&#xff08;3&#xff09;可以将元素按照规则进行排序TreeSet()&#xff1a;根据其元素的自然排序进行排序TreeSet(Comparator comparator) &#xff1a;根据指定的比较器进行…

资源受限设备也能跑大模型?AutoGLM-Phone-9B部署实测分享

资源受限设备也能跑大模型&#xff1f;AutoGLM-Phone-9B部署实测分享 随着多模态大语言模型&#xff08;MLLM&#xff09;在视觉理解、语音交互和文本生成等任务中的广泛应用&#xff0c;其对算力和存储资源的高要求一直限制着在移动端和边缘设备上的落地。然而&#xff0c;Au…

5个YOLOv9部署教程推荐:一键镜像开箱即用,省时提效

5个YOLOv9部署教程推荐&#xff1a;一键镜像开箱即用&#xff0c;省时提效 1. 镜像环境说明 本镜像基于 YOLOv9 官方代码库构建&#xff0c;预装了完整的深度学习开发环境&#xff0c;集成了训练、推理及评估所需的所有依赖&#xff0c;开箱即用。适用于快速开展目标检测任务…

Qwen3-VL-2B对比Blip-2:轻量级模型部署体验评测

Qwen3-VL-2B对比Blip-2&#xff1a;轻量级模型部署体验评测 1. 引言&#xff1a;轻量级多模态模型的落地挑战 随着多模态大模型在图文理解、视觉问答等场景中的广泛应用&#xff0c;如何在资源受限环境下实现高效部署成为工程实践中的关键问题。Qwen3-VL-2B 和 Blip-2 是当前…

MGeo真实体验分享:地址匹配准确率提升40%

MGeo真实体验分享&#xff1a;地址匹配准确率提升40% 1. 引言&#xff1a;中文地址匹配的挑战与MGeo的突破 在地理信息处理、物流调度、城市计算等实际业务场景中&#xff0c;地址相似度匹配是一项基础但极具挑战性的任务。其核心目标是判断两条文本形式的地址是否指向现实世…

超详细版对比USB 3.0 3.1 3.2在移动硬盘中的实际表现

为什么你的移动硬盘跑不满标称速度&#xff1f;一文看懂USB 3.0、3.1、3.2的真实差距你有没有遇到过这种情况&#xff1a;花大价钱买了个“高速NVMe移动固态硬盘”&#xff0c;包装上赫然写着“传输速度高达2000MB/s”&#xff0c;结果插上电脑一测&#xff0c;读写连1000都不到…

架构演进:从数据库“裸奔”到多级防护

噗&#xff0c;这个标题是不是有点AI味&#xff1f;哈哈&#xff0c;确实有让AI起名&#xff0c;但只是起了个名&#xff0c;我原来的标题是&#xff1a;“给你的数据接口提提速&#xff0c;聊聊二级缓存的架构设计” 前言 前阵子给项目做了点性能优化&#xff0c;最核心的手段…

Qwen3-1.7B微调前后对比,效果提升一目了然

Qwen3-1.7B微调前后对比&#xff0c;效果提升一目了然 1. 引言&#xff1a;为何要对Qwen3-1.7B进行微调&#xff1f; 随着大语言模型在垂直领域应用的不断深入&#xff0c;通用预训练模型虽然具备广泛的知识覆盖能力&#xff0c;但在特定专业场景&#xff08;如医疗、法律、金…

从口语到标准格式|用FST ITN-ZH镜像实现中文逆文本精准转换

从口语到标准格式&#xff5c;用FST ITN-ZH镜像实现中文逆文本精准转换 在语音识别和自然语言处理的实际应用中&#xff0c;一个常被忽视但至关重要的环节是逆文本标准化&#xff08;Inverse Text Normalization, ITN&#xff09;。当用户说出“二零零八年八月八日”或“早上八…

边缘太生硬?开启羽化让AI抠图更自然流畅

边缘太生硬&#xff1f;开启羽化让AI抠图更自然流畅 1. 背景与技术痛点 在图像处理、电商展示、社交媒体内容创作等场景中&#xff0c;高质量的图像抠图是提升视觉表现力的关键环节。传统手动抠图依赖专业设计工具和大量人力操作&#xff0c;效率低下&#xff1b;而早期自动抠…

Wan2.2部署实战:医疗科普动画AI生成的内容合规性把控

Wan2.2部署实战&#xff1a;医疗科普动画AI生成的内容合规性把控 1. 引言 随着人工智能技术的快速发展&#xff0c;文本到视频&#xff08;Text-to-Video&#xff09;生成模型在内容创作领域展现出巨大潜力。特别是在医疗科普场景中&#xff0c;如何高效、准确且合规地生成可…

Qwen3-Embedding-4B镜像推荐:开箱即用的向量服务方案

Qwen3-Embedding-4B镜像推荐&#xff1a;开箱即用的向量服务方案 1. 背景与需求分析 随着大模型在检索增强生成&#xff08;RAG&#xff09;、语义搜索、多模态理解等场景中的广泛应用&#xff0c;高质量文本嵌入&#xff08;Text Embedding&#xff09;能力已成为构建智能系…

Qwen3-Embedding-4B省钱策略:低峰期调度部署方案

Qwen3-Embedding-4B省钱策略&#xff1a;低峰期调度部署方案 1. 背景与问题提出 在大规模语言模型日益普及的今天&#xff0c;向量嵌入服务已成为检索增强生成&#xff08;RAG&#xff09;、语义搜索、推荐系统等应用的核心基础设施。Qwen3-Embedding-4B 作为通义千问系列中专…

小白必看!一键配置Linux开机启动脚本的保姆级指南

小白必看&#xff01;一键配置Linux开机启动脚本的保姆级指南 1. 引言&#xff1a;为什么需要开机启动脚本&#xff1f; 在实际的 Linux 系统运维和开发中&#xff0c;我们常常需要某些程序或脚本在系统启动时自动运行。例如&#xff1a; 启动一个后台服务&#xff08;如 Py…

Qwen2.5-7B显存优化方案:16GB GPU高效运行实战

Qwen2.5-7B显存优化方案&#xff1a;16GB GPU高效运行实战 1. 引言 1.1 业务场景描述 随着大语言模型在实际应用中的广泛落地&#xff0c;如何在有限硬件资源下高效部署高性能模型成为工程团队的核心挑战。通义千问Qwen2.5-7B-Instruct作为最新一代70亿参数级别的指令微调模…